My Buying Guides on Camper Bunk Bed Mattress
When I first ventured into the world of camping, I quickly realized that a good night’s sleep was essential for making the most of my adventures. One of the key components to achieving that restful slumber was finding the right camper bunk bed mattress. Here’s what I learned along the way that can help you make an informed decision.
1. Understanding Mattress Types
When I started my search, I discovered that there are several types of mattresses available for camper bunk beds. Each type has its own benefits:
- Memory Foam: I love memory foam for its ability to conform to my body, providing excellent support and comfort. It’s great for those chilly nights because it retains heat well, but I found that it can be heavy and may retain moisture.
- Innerspring: For me, innerspring mattresses are the classic choice. They provide good support and breathability. If you prefer a firmer feel, this might be the way to go.
- Hybrid: This combination of memory foam and innerspring gives me the best of both worlds. I appreciate the support of coils with the comfort of foam, making it a versatile option for various sleeping positions.
- Air Mattresses: While not my first choice, I’ve found that inflatable mattresses can be a lightweight option for short trips. Just be cautious of punctures and ensure you have a pump handy.
2. Mattress Size and Fit
I learned that camper bunk beds come in various sizes, so measuring the space is crucial. My experience has taught me to take accurate measurements of the bunk bed frame to ensure a snug fit. Most camper mattresses are typically thinner than standard mattresses, so look for options specifically designed for RVs or campers.
3. Thickness Matters
The thickness of the mattress can significantly impact comfort. I found that a mattress between 4 to 6 inches thick is ideal for a bunk bed. This thickness provides enough support without taking up too much space. However, if I want extra comfort, I might consider a slightly thicker option, but that’s a balancing act with available headroom.
4. Weight Considerations
Since I often move my camper, the weight of the mattress is an essential factor. Lightweight mattresses are easier to handle and transport. When choosing a mattress, I made sure to consider its weight, especially if I need to lift it in and out of the camper frequently.
5. Durability and Material Quality
In my experience, investing in a durable mattress pays off in the long run. I look for high-quality materials that can withstand the wear and tear of camping. Waterproof or water-resistant covers are a bonus, especially if I’m camping in humid conditions or near water.
6. Comfort Levels
Comfort is subjective, and what works for me may not work for you. I recommend trying out different mattresses if possible. If you can’t test it in person, I always read customer reviews to gauge comfort levels from other campers. Look for mattresses that offer a balance of firmness and softness based on your sleeping preferences.
7. Budgeting for Your Mattress
I found that camper bunk bed mattresses can range widely in price. Setting a budget helped me narrow down my options. While I didn’t want to skimp on quality, I also didn’t want to break the bank. I discovered that many affordable mattresses provide great comfort and durability, so it’s worth exploring various price points.
8. Maintenance and Care
Finally, I learned that taking care of my mattress prolongs its lifespan. I make sure to regularly clean it and use mattress protectors to guard against spills, moisture, and dirt. When not in use, I store it in a dry place to prevent mold and mildew.
